Eight Shanah Tovah postcards with scenes from the Holy Land, various publishers and years of print – Germany, the Land of Israel and additional places. Early 20th century.
Includes: Shanah Tovah card without divisional lines by Zion publishing Vienna, depicting “a Jewish colony in the Land of Israel”; unique postcard with relief of Rachel’s Tomb and the environs, designed by N. Beilis; photo postcard depicting David’s tomb; postcard depicting the train to Palestine with pioneers working the land in front of the engine, with the [Hebrew] text: “L’Shanah Tovah, Shecheyanu V’Kiyimanu …” and more.
Postcards: 14×9 cm. Overall fine condition.
